Abstract

Provided is an imaging device that includes a pixel array section including a plurality of dynamic vision sensor (DVS) pixels that outputs a luminance signal according to a light amount, and a detection circuit section that is disposed outside the pixel array section and outputs a detection signal indicating occurrence of an address event in a case where the luminance signal of each of the plurality of DVS pixels exceeds a predetermined threshold value. Furthermore, each of DVS pixel includes a photoelectric conversion element that outputs a signal corresponding to a light amount, a logarithmic conversion circuit that logarithmically converts the signal, a signal holding circuit that holds the luminance signal converted by the logarithmic conversion circuit, and a readout circuit that reads the luminance signal held in the signal holding circuit.
